Crime rate in Pembroke Dock: Market
Crime rate
Crime rate
20.06 per 1,000 people
Percentile
22nd percentile nationally
Crime data appears weaker than most neighbourhoods nationally.
House prices in Pembroke Dock: Market
House prices
Average sold price
£157,000
Percentile
9th percentile nationally
House prices appear lower than many neighbourhoods nationally.
